Kaalan Walker Sentenced To 50 Years In Prison On Multiple Rape Charges

Actor and rapper Kaalan Walker has been convicted of raping multiple women and was sentenced to 50 years to life in prison. 

According to reports, Walker was convicted in April on two counts of rape by intoxication, three counts of forcible rape, and two counts of statutory rape. The two counts of forcible rape and one count of forcible digital penetration, Walker was acquitted of. 

In 2018, Walker was arrested after many women went to the LAPD claiming that they were sexually assaulted by him going all the way back to 2013. The Los Angeles Times reported, “The rapper’s victims, who were models, alleged that Walker reached out to them over social media offering to help them professionally, police said.” 

They went on to say, “Walker would lure his victims to locations by telling them there was a music video shoot or that he was going to introduce them to someone famous, City News Service reported. When he was alone with the women, he sexually assaulted them, his victims told police.” 

Kaalan Walker was ordered by Superior Court Judge Joseph Brandolino to register as a sex offender for the rest of his life.
